You can adjust:
Language - You can select the menu's language to English,
Español or Français.
Menu Settings - You can set On-screen menu system.
Timeout: Select the display time of the menu: 10-20-...-
60 seconds.
Time Setup - Set the time zone, daylight saving, time and
sleep timer.
Time Zone: Select your local time zone: Eastern Time,
Indiana, Central Time, Mountain Time, Arizona, Pacific
Time, Alaska or Hawaii.
Daylight Saving: Set the Daylight Saving time for your
area.
Time: You can set time manually or select automatic if
the TV is connected to an antenna or cable source.

Auto Synchronization: Select "On" for automatic
date and time setting using information from broadcast
stations in your area.
Date/Time: Set the current year/month/day/time.
Power On Timer: When "On", you can set the time
when the TV turns on automatically.
Time: Set the desired time for the TV to turn on
automatically.
Power Off Timer: When "On", you can set the time
when the TV turns off automatically.
Time: Set the desired time for the TV to turn off
automatically.

Sleep Timer: Specify the amount of time before your TV
automatically turns off: Off -10-...-120 minutes.
Caption - Adjust Closed Captioning settings.
Caption Control: Select the Closed Caption mode: CC
Off, CC On or CC On When Mute.
Analog Closed Caption: Select an Analog Caption
setting:
CC1~CC4: Closed captioning appears in a small
banner across the bottom of the screen. CC1 is usually
the "printed" version of the audio. CC2~CC4 display
content are provided by the broadcaster.
Text1~Text4: Closed captioning that covers half or
all of the screen. Text1~Text4 display content are
provided by the broadcaster.
Off: To turn off the Analog Caption.
Digital Closed Caption: Select a Digital Caption setting:
Service1~Service6 or Off.
Digital Caption Style: Customize the look of digital
Closed Captioning.

Caption Style: Set the look of Digital CC. "As
Broadcaster" uses broadcaster's style.
Font Size/Style/Color/Opacity: Select the size/style/
color/opacity level of font.
Background Color/Opacity: Select the color/opacity
level of the background.
Window Color: Select the color of the window.
Network - You can setup the network configuration in this
menu. For more information, see "Network Connection" and
"Network Setup".
Demo Mode - Displays a banner at the bottom of the screen
which describes the key features of the TV.
Version Info - Display the software version information.
You may need to reference this information when contacting
Customer Care or upgrading the firmware online.
Reset Default - Restores the TV configuration to factory
settings. You will need to complete the setup for such things
as Tuner/Channel settings, Network connection, Date/Time
and other user preferences.
